The Disneyland theme park that features Mickey's famous ears in its logo is Disneyland Resort in California. The iconic silhouette of Mickey Mouse's ears is a recognizable symbol associated with the park, representing its connection to the beloved character and Disney's overall brand. This logo is prominently displayed in various promotional materials and merchandise related to the park.
